Get to Know the Poult : All About Infant Fowl

Have you ever encountered a miniature ball of fluff pecking around? It might have been a poult! These adorable young birds are newly hatched and incredibly vulnerable. A poult's life begins in an nest , and after about 28 days, they emerge as fluffy, yellow hatchlings. They’re completely needy on their parent for warmth and food, primarily consuming bugs and plants. You can often find them following their guardian closely – a truly endearing sight!

Distinguishing Male and Female Turkeys

Identifying the tom versus the lady turkey isn't always straightforward, but there are several differences to observe. Usually , males, or toms , possess much more brilliant plumage, displaying a glossy bronze coloration and a prominent, fleshy beard under their chin – the length of which can indicate maturity. Hens usually have less bright feathers, ranging in shades of brown and tan, providing excellent camouflage during nesting. Furthermore, a tom’s voice is often a distinct "gobble," while hens tend to emit quieter noises . Size can also be a indicator; toms are generally greater than their female counterparts.
